The postclassic maya dresden codex contains extensive astronomical records in the form of calendrical and chronological intervals concerning multiple cycles of the sun, the moon, and several visible planets.

Maya codices singular codex are folding books stemming from the precolumbian maya civilization, written in maya hieroglyphic script on mesoamerican paper, made from the inner bark of certain trees, the main being the wild fig tree or amate ficus glabrata, this paper was named by the mayas huun, and contained many glyph and paintings. We first learn of the dresden codex when we hear that johann christian gotze, director of the royal library at dresden, obtained the codex from the private owner in vienna in 1739.
